My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Hey there, I'm Siku. My Inuit name means "Sea Ice" and I'm a bright white Siberian Husky with a kind heart. I sing a gentle wooo wooo to alert you when I have a message for you.

Our former family took us to a shelter where my blue-eyed sister was immediately adopted. There I was alone, with a blue eye and a brown eye and the clock ticking. I was happy to get an invitation to this sanctuary! I've been here for awhile, getting excellent care and good food to strengthen my immune system -- and my rescue mom has admitted she was not in a big hurry to see me go, because I have been such a comfort to the newcomers over the past year. But she says it's my turn now, to find my very own family. I could be a good friend to another dog, or I could happily be your one and only dog, if you will spend a lot of time with me and take me outdoors.

I'm spayed, vaccinated, heart worm negative, and house trained. My adoption fee is $150.00.
